sounds like your battery charge may be low. It's recommended to have it at 50% or higher before attempting to flash firmware. But yes, once you have enough of a charge, you should be able to wipe the cache partition as follows (from the instructions in the thread i linked to previously): :)

- with your device off simultaneously press and hold volume up/home/power buttons until you see android system recovery at the top of the screen and a green android laying down with a red triangle above him in the center of the screen.
- scroll down using the volume down button and highlight "wipe cache partition" and press the power button to select
- when it says cache wipe complete at the bottom and "reboot system now" is highlight press the power button to reboot and enjoy!

If you used the stock rooted rom file, then you're rooted. To confirm this, once the phone boots, you'll see super su in the app drawer. You can also use the app root checker to actually confirm root access.
